The Boo Radleys

Shaped in Liverpool in 1988, the English guitar pop group the Boo Radleys created an ardent cult pursuing in the first ’90s before crossing more than in to the mainstream in the center of the decade. Originally, the Radleys had been among the smaller lights from the noisy, loud My Bloody Valentine-inspired psychedelic trance pop rings labeled “shoegazers” from the English every week music press. From the middle-’90s the Boo Radleys experienced developed into a far more straightforward pop music group who didn’t make use of noise and prolonged guitar workouts as a means of fleshing out their tunes, instead deploying it because the basis of their music. The Boo Radleys originally contains guitarist/songwriter Martin Carr, vocalist/guitarist Sice, bassist Timothy Dark brown, and drummer Steve Hewitt. The music group released their 1st recording, Ichabod and I, on an area impartial record label in 1990; Hewitt was changed by Rob Cieka following the release from the record. Using the support of important British disk jockey John Peel off, the music group signed with Tough Trade Information. The group released the EP Every Heaven in 1991; the record managed to get in to the lower parts of the U.K. graphs. Tough Trade folded soon after the discharge of each Heaven, as well as the Boo Radleys relocated to Creation Information, liberating Everything’s Alright Forever in 1992. Everything’s Alright Forever premiered within the U.S. through Creation’s association with Columbia Information, nonetheless it didn’t gain very much attention in the us. In Britain, it received beneficial reviews as well as the group started to develop a group of fans. Topping many Best-of-the-Year lists, including Melody Maker’s, 1993’s Large Steps was a crucial success in Britain and offered respectably. IN THE US, the record released the minor option rock strike “Lazarus” and resulted in second-stage i’m all over this Lollapalooza ’94. Released in Britain within the springtime of 1995, the greater pop-oriented AWAKEN! was the band’s business discovery, debuting at number 1. The shiny, horn-driven solitary “AWAKEN Boo” joined in the very best Ten and remained on the graphs before early summer, avoiding the follow-up solitary, “Find the solution Within,” from charting greater than the very best 30. AWAKEN! was released in the us in nov 1995 without promotional press from Columbia, who lowered the music group early the next season. The Boo Radleys came back in nov 1996 with C’Mon Children, a self-consciously noisy and arty record designed to get rid of the band’s newfound pop enthusiasts. It proved helpful — the record debuted in the very best Ten nonetheless it shortly fell from the graphs, despite overwhelmingly reviews that are positive. Early in 1997, the music group finalized an American agreement with Mercury, and C’Mon Children premiered in March, a half of a year following its preliminary British discharge. Kingsize implemented in past due 1998, although group officially split up simply months afterwards. Carr continued to form Daring Captain. In 2005 the Boo Radleys released Find just how Out, a thorough two-disc retrospective filled with exhuastive liner records and memories through the music group.
